Carbon dioxide emissions per unit of GDP PPP in Pakistan
Pakistan: Carbon dioxide emissions per unit of GDP PPP was 0.1135 in 2023. ▼ Falling
Carbon dioxide emissions per unit of GDP PPP in Pakistan, 2000–2023
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database.
Analysis
The most recent figure for carbon dioxide emissions per unit of gdp ppp in Pakistan is 0.1135, measured in 2023.
The figure is up 0.1% on the previous year and down 18.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, carbon dioxide emissions per unit of gdp ppp in Pakistan peaked at 0.1699 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 0.1134, in 2022.
That places Pakistan 93rd out of 159 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 24 years of available data.
Carbon dioxide emissions per unit of GDP PPP in Pakistan,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 0.1699 | — |
| 2001 | 0.1658 | -2.5% |
| 2002 | 0.1658 | +0.0% |
| 2003 | 0.1618 | -2.4% |
| 2004 | 0.1685 | +4.1% |
| 2005 | 0.1591 | -5.5% |
| 2006 | 0.163 | +2.4% |
| 2007 | 0.1699 | +4.3% |
| 2008 | 0.1556 | -8.4% |
| 2009 | 0.1579 | +1.5% |
| 2010 | 0.1491 | -5.6% |
| 2011 | 0.1462 | -2.0% |
| 2012 | 0.1434 | -1.9% |
| 2013 | 0.1389 | -3.1% |
| 2014 | 0.1424 | +2.5% |
| 2015 | 0.1463 | +2.7% |
| 2016 | 0.1551 | +6.0% |
| 2017 | 0.1636 | +5.5% |
| 2018 | 0.1436 | -12.2% |
| 2019 | 0.137 | -4.6% |
| 2020 | 0.156 | +13.9% |
| 2021 | 0.1512 | -3.1% |
| 2022 | 0.1134 | -25.0% |
| 2023 | 0.1135 | +0.1% |
